Output 6efbeafbef200c7f12c83da1fd2da2d847d4b8e2bfbe7a49eb3f602de2e00c70:1

value
4973859953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 786100cb864ab7e948a31690e3201154b72e9729 OP_EQUAL
address
3CfXDTUjFo1agwBeirHTTkZuWkJ1hHSo7q
transaction
6efbeafbef200c7f12c83da1fd2da2d847d4b8e2bfbe7a49eb3f602de2e00c70
spent
true